CAS 391211-97-5
:Benzoic acid, 3,4-difluoro-2-[(2-fluoro-4-iodophenyl)amino]-
Description:
Benzoic acid, 3,4-difluoro-2-[(2-fluoro-4-iodophenyl)amino]- is a chemical compound characterized by its aromatic structure, which includes a benzoic acid moiety substituted with multiple halogen atoms. The presence of fluorine and iodine atoms in the structure contributes to its unique chemical properties, such as increased lipophilicity and potential reactivity in electrophilic substitution reactions. The difluoro substitutions at the 3 and 4 positions of the benzoic acid ring enhance its electron-withdrawing characteristics, which can influence its acidity and reactivity. The amino group attached to the aromatic ring can participate in hydrogen bonding and may affect the compound's solubility in various solvents. This compound may have applications in pharmaceuticals or materials science due to its specific functional groups and structural features. Additionally, the presence of halogens can impart bi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. Overall, the compound's unique combination of functional groups and substituents makes it a subject of interest for further research and application.
Formula:C13H7F3INO2
Synonyms:- 2-(2-Fluoro-4-iodoanilino)-3,4-difluorobenzoic Acid
